Involvement of private sector stakeholders in policy formulation process stressed

Business leaders at a workshop opined that  it is very important to involve the private sector stakeholders and experts in the process of formulating any policy. 

Bangladesh Chamber of Industries (BCI) organised the training workshop on “Practical Aspects of Customs and VAT Related Laws and Regulations” at the BCI Boardroom.

Abdul Hai Sarkar, Chairman, Bangladesh Association of Banks (BAB), was present as the chief guest at the workshop with Anwar-ul Alam Chowdhury (Pervez), President of BCI, in the chair. 

Tarek Hasan, First Secretary, Customs, NBR and Barrister Md. Badruzzaman Munshi, Second Secretary, VAT Policy, NBR were present as facilitators.

30 representatives from various institutions and sectors participated in the workshop while BCI Director Dr. Delwar Hossain Raja was present at the workshop. 

In his speech as the chief guest, Abdul Hai Sarkar, Chairman, BAB, said that there is a kind of distance between our tax payers and those who collect taxes. If this distance can be reduced, problems in tax collection and management will be reduced.

He expressed the opinion that it is very important to involve the private sector while formulating any policy. 

In the second part of the workshop Tarek Hasan, First Secretary, Customs, NBR and Barrister Md. Badruzzaman Munshi, Second Secretary, VAT Policy, NBR discussed various aspects of laws and regulations related to Customs and VAT and answered various questions from the participants.
